Number of suicides in Burkina Faso
Burkina Faso: Number of suicides was 1,858 deaths in 2021. ▲ Rising
Number of suicides in Burkina Faso, 2000–2021
Source: World Health Organization (2024) – with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in deaths.
Analysis
Burkina Faso recorded 1,858 deaths for number of suicides in 2021. That is the highest value across all 22 years on record.
That represents a change of up 4.6% on the previous year and up 30.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of suicides in Burkina Faso peaked at 1,858 deaths in 2021 and was at its lowest, 1,075 deaths, in 2000.
That places Burkina Faso 49th out of 194 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 22 years of available data.
